Eligibility Criteria for the Nominee
- The nominee must be a natural person (not a company or legal entity).
- Must be an Indian citizen.
- Must be a resident in India, meaning they have stayed in India for at least 120 days during the preceding financial year.
- The nominee must not be a nominee in any other OPC at the same time.
- The nominee must also not be a member or owner of another OPC.
Consent from the Nominee
- A written consent must be obtained from the nominee before company incorporation.
- This consent is given through Form INC-3, as per the Companies Act requirements.
- The nominee must be made aware of their rights, responsibilities, and role.
- This document ensures the nominee agrees to take over the company in case of the member’s insolvency or incapacity.
- The form must be filed with the Registrar of Companies during the incorporation process.
Documentation Requirements
- Identity proof of the nominee, such as a PAN card or an Aadhaar card.
- Address proof, such as a recent utility bill or bank statement (not older than 2 months).
- A passport-size photograph of the nominee.
- Duly signed Form INC-3 (Nominee Consent Form) with supporting documents.
- The documents must be valid, clear, and uploaded electronically with the incorporation form.
Nominee’s Role and Responsibility
- The nominee is not involved in the management or operations during the lifetime of the original member.
- The nominee’s role is passive until triggered by incapacity, or disqualification of the original member.
- Once triggered, the nominee becomes the new sole member of the OPC automatically.
- The nominee may either accept the position or choose to withdraw from it with appropriate filings.
- The nominee may resign by submitting a written notice and allowing a new nominee to be appointed.
Change or Withdrawal of Nominee
- The original member can change the nominee at any time after incorporation.
- A new Form INC-4 must be filed with the Registrar for both withdrawal and new consent.
- The outgoing nominee must provide a declaration of withdrawal.
- The new nominee must submit a fresh Form INC-3 with the required documents and consent.
- The change must be recorded in company records and approved by the board, if applicable.
